What is Hatha Yoga?

The foundation of all yoga styles, Hatha focuses on physical postures and breathing techniques. Perfect for beginners, it builds strength, flexibility, and body awareness at a gentle, accessible pace — creating a balanced mind-body connection through deliberate movement and mindful breath.

Benefits of Hatha Yoga Classes in Honolulu

Whether you're new to Hatha Yoga in Honolulu or returning to the mat, here are the key benefits practitioners report:

  • Foundation for all yoga: Hatha builds the fundamental poses and breathing techniques that underpin every other style — the ideal starting point for beginners.
  • Improved flexibility: Structured poses safely lengthen muscles and increase range of motion at a pace suitable for all bodies and ages.
  • Core and postural strength: Alignment-focused instruction corrects common postural imbalances and builds functional core stability over time.
  • Stress and anxiety relief: Breathwork and meditation woven into every class activate the parasympathetic nervous system and measurably lower cortisol.
  • Joint health: Low-impact movement lubricates joints and maintains mobility, making it ideal for all ages and fitness levels.
  • Body awareness: Deliberate, slow movement develops proprioception and mindfulness that carries into everyday life off the mat.

Hatha Yoga vs Vinyasa Yoga vs Yin Yoga

Unsure which style suits you? Here's how Hatha Yoga in Honolulu compares to the most commonly confused alternatives.

AspectHatha YogaVinyasa YogaYin Yoga
PaceSlow to moderate; each pose held and explainedFast-flowing; continuous movement linked by breathVery slow; poses held 3–5 minutes each
IntensityLow to moderateModerate to highLow — passive, not athletic
Flexibility focusModerate; alignment-led stretchingDynamic; range of motion through movementDeep; targets connective tissue and fascia
Sweat levelLight to moderateModerate to highMinimal
Beginner-friendlyVery — the most accessible yoga styleModerate — moves quickly for newcomersYes — no strength or flexibility required
Main goalFoundation, alignment, body awarenessFitness, creative flow, cardiovascular healthDeep tissue release, nervous system rest
Best forBeginners, older adults, mindful moversFitness enthusiasts, variety seekersAthletes recovering, stressed or tense people

First Time Doing Hatha Yoga in Honolulu? Here's What to Know

  1. 1

    What to bring

    A yoga mat, water bottle, and comfortable clothes you can move in. Props like blocks and straps are usually provided or available to rent.

  2. 2

    Arrive early

    Get there 10 minutes before class to introduce yourself to the instructor and let them know it's your first time.

  3. 3

    Forget about flexibility

    Hatha yoga moves at a gentle pace and focuses on alignment, not flexibility. You don't need to be flexible to start — that's what the practice builds.
